*It seems that Dallas Austin has had a change of heart - or maybe his lawyers had a sit down with him - as far as his raunchy rants about singers Joss Stone and Christina Aguilera are concerned.
In Monday's EUR we reported on the video in which the Grammy winning producer made detailed accounts of sexing Christina Aguilera and her obsession with him. Austin also alleges that Aguilera and Stone had sex with producers in exchange for music. Or has he put it, "all these bitches be f**kin' for tracks.” But, on Tuesday, Austin switched up and issued the following statement to the Atlanta Journal-Constitution: “Every action generates an equal and opposite reaction. My statement about Christina Aguilera and Joss Stone was a reaction to an incident I care not to discuss in any forum, and while I may have felt justified, I do owe an apology to Christina, Joss and their families. “The comments I made about Christina Aguilera and Joss Stone were purely an act of retaliation not of malice or cruel intent. As we all have our boiling points, I sincerely apologize as this is not my character nor should I have let anyone’s actions push me to this limit. I have let my family, friends, employees and business associates down with my actions. “All content and any malicious statements that were in my control have been removed from outlets that may have posted this. “Please accept this as my formal statement and apology to all parties involved.”
